Protocol summary

Study aim
The aim of this study was to investigate the effect of dry needle on the subacromial space(SAS).
Design
The clinical trial has two non-randomized and parallel groups of intervention and control with 3 months follow-up and designed for 30 samples which are entered into each of the intervention or control groups one by one according to the order of entering the research.
Settings and conduct
The research is being done in Tehran at Raz physiotherapy clinic and Mehregan radiology institute. Samples are selected from clients who are eligible to enter the research and have the willingness to participate. The study is single-blind and the colleague who measures the subacromial shoulder-distance by ultrasound before and after the intervention does not know about grouping.
Participants/Inclusion and exclusion criteria
People with subacromial shoulder pain syndrome referred to Raz Physiotherapy Center in 2021-2022 except for those with heart problems, injuries such as fractures, dislocations or trauma
Intervention groups
The intervention includes performing physical therapy on the painful shoulder. In the intervention group, dry needling is added to this treatment and at the end of the session, a dry needle is applied to the scapular levator muscles, rhomboids, as well as the active trigger points found in the first, third, fifth, seventh, and ninth sessions.
Main outcome variables
Shoulder Pain; Shoulder Disability; Shoulder Subacromial ِDistance

Inclusion/Exclusion criteria
Inclusion criteria:
People with subacromial shoulder pain syndrome Decreased subacromial space
Exclusion criteria:
History of fractures and dislocations in the scapula and shoulder area History of scapula and shoulder surgery Neurological symptoms in the upper extremities such as sensory and motor disorders Frozen shoulder and severe neck pain Congenital skeletal abnormalities Inflammatory joint disease such as rheumatoid arthritis Performing treatments such as dry needling, topical corticosteroids injection, PRP and ozone therapy during the last 3 months Fear of needles and taking Anticoagulant for dry needle group

Intervention groups

1

Description
Control group: Physiotherapy is performed on the painful shoulder. Physiotherapy treatment modalities include TENS, Ultrasound, and Infrared radiation. These devices include TENS Model 62L and Ultrasound Model 215A provided by Novin Medical Engineering Company. Passive, active and resistance exercises are performed for 25 minutes to increase range of motion, reduce pain and strengthen of the Serratus Anterior, Lower and Middle Trapezius, Pectoralis Major, Latissimus Dorsi, Teres Major, Deltoid, Supraspinatus, Infraspinatus, Teres Minor muscles.
Category
Rehabilitation

2

Description
Intervention group: In the intervention group, dry needling is added to physiotherapy treatment and at the end of the physiotherapy session, dry needling intervention is applied to the Levator Scapula muscles, Rhomboids as well as active trigger points found in the first, third, fifth, seventh and ninth sessions.
